آموزش خدمات وب با Node.js و Express را آرام کنید

RESTful Web Services with Node.js and Express

نکته: آخرین آپدیت رو دریافت میکنید حتی اگر این محتوا بروز نباشد.
نمونه ویدیویی برای نمایش وجود ندارد.
توضیحات دوره: Node.js ابزاری ساده و قدرتمند برای توسعه backend است. وقتی با Express ترکیب شده باشید ، می توانید سریع و ساده API سبک ، سریع و مقیاس پذیر ایجاد کنید. با استفاده از REST ، این API ها برای استفاده بیشتر از API های شما ساده و کاربرپسند می شوند. همه را بزرگ کنید بررسی اجمالی دوره 1m 32s REST چیست؟ 25 متر 3 ثانیه گرفتن داده 22 متر 14 ثانیه ارسال اطلاعات 14m 29s به روز رسانی داده ها 18m 55s آزمایش کردن 29m 20s HATEOAS 11 متر 8 ثانیه علائم تجاری و نام تجاری اشخاص ثالث ذکر شده در این دوره متعلق به صاحبان مربوطه می باشند و Pluralsight وابسته یا تأیید شده توسط این احزاب نیست.

سرفصل ها و درس ها

بررسی اجمالی دوره Course Overview

  • بررسی اجمالی دوره Course Overview

REST چیست؟ What Is REST?

  • مقدمه Introduction

  • استراحت چیست؟ What Is Rest?

  • رابط یکنواخت Uniform Interface

  • تنظیم محیط Setting up Your Environment

  • تنظیم برخی از ابزارها Setting up Some Tooling

  • خلاصه Summary

گرفتن داده Getting Data

  • مقدمه Introduction

  • پیاده سازی HTTP GET Implementing HTTP GET

  • سیم کشی تا MongoDB Wiring up to MongoDB

  • فیلتر کردن با یک رشته کوئری Filtering with a Query String

  • دریافت یک مورد منفرد Getting a Single Item

  • خلاصه Summary

ارسال اطلاعات Posting Data

  • مقدمه Introduction

  • تجزیه و تحلیل داده های POST با Body Parser Parsing POST Data with Body Parser

  • آزمایش با پستچی Testing with Postman

  • ذخیره داده Saving Data

  • پاکسازی کد Code Cleanup

  • تزریق مدل کتاب Injecting the Book Model

  • خلاصه Summary

به روز رسانی داده ها Updating Data

  • مقدمه Introduction

  • پیاده سازی Implementing PUT

  • در حال آزمایش قرار دادن Testing PUT

  • میان افزار Middleware

  • در حال اجرا PATCH Implementing PATCH

  • در حال آزمایش PATCH Testing PATCH

  • در حال انجام حذف Implementing DELETE

  • خلاصه Summary

آزمایش کردن Testing

  • مقدمه Introduction

  • کنترل کننده ها Controllers

  • پستچی و اشکالات Postman and Bugs

  • آزمایش با موکا Testing with Mocha

  • تست های در حال اجرا Running Tests

  • تست های ادغام Integration Tests

  • خلاصه Summary

HATEOAS HATEOAS

  • مقدمه Introduction

  • پیمایش در API شما Navigating Your API

  • افزودن هایپر مدیا Adding Hypermedia

  • خلاصه Summary

نمایش نظرات

آموزش خدمات وب با Node.js و Express را آرام کنید
جزییات دوره
2h 2m
39
Pluralsight (پلورال سایت) Pluralsight (پلورال سایت)
(آخرین آپدیت)
171
4.5 از 5
دارد
دارد
دارد
جهت دریافت آخرین اخبار و آپدیت ها در کانال تلگرام عضو شوید.

Google Chrome Browser

Internet Download Manager

Pot Player

Winrar

Jonathan Mills Jonathan Mills

جاناتان نویسنده Pluralsight ، مشاور فناوری و رهبر تجارت است. جاناتان به عنوان عضوی از تیم مشاور ارشد دیجیتال در فناوری جهانی جهانی ، می تواند از تجربیات و مهارت های منحصر به فرد خود برای ایجاد تحول دیجیتال برای مشتریان خود استفاده کند. جاناتان به عنوان یک رهبر اختصاصی برای توسعه دهندگان ، در هیئت مدیره کنفرانس توسعه دهندگان کانزاس سیتی فعالیت می کند ، MVP مایکروسافت است و به عنوان سخنران ثابت و سخنران اصلی در کنفرانس های سراسر جهان است.